导读:本文围绕TPWallet最新版从BSC向ERC链转移(跨链桥接)这一实际场景,逐项剖析零日攻击防护、全球化数字平台构建、专家级技术洞见、数字化生活方式对产品设计的影响、链码(智能合约)安全治理与高性能数据库架构建议,给出工程与运营层面的实用建议。
一、BSC→ERC跨链转移架构要点
- 常见模型:托管桥(custodial)、锁定铸造(lock-mint)、原子互换与中继证明(relayer+Merkle proof)。TPWallet可选用“轻验证+多签验证器+事件证明”组合,源链(BSC)将资产锁定并生成可验证事件,目标链(Ethereum)发行对应的包装资产(wrapped token)。
- 关键要素:不可抵赖的事件证据、可信的中继器集、最终性界定(确认数)、回滚/补偿流程。
二、防零日攻击(Zero-day)策略
- 减少攻击面:最小化合约逻辑、把复杂业务放在链下可信服务或多签裁决层。
- 形式化与工具链:使用静态分析、符号执行(MythX、Slither)、模糊测试与形式化验证(Certora、K-framework)对关键合约进行验证。
- 运行时防护:多签+Timelock、紧急暂停(circuit breaker)、速率限制、白名单与灰度放行、黑盒行为监测与可疑交易回溯。
- 供应链安全:锁定依赖版本、构建可复现二进制、持续依赖扫描(SCA)。
- 响应流程:建立零日响应SOP(隔离、通告、快速回滚/迁移、补丁发布、取证与溯源),并配合赏金计划(bug bounty)。

三、全球化数字平台考量
- 合规与数据边界:多司法管辖区合规(KYC/AML、数据隐私),地域化部署以满足法规与低延迟需求。
- 本地化体验:多语言、货币显示、本地支付与法币入口,抽象Gas概念(meta-transactions、gasless方案)以降低门槛。
- 运维与监控:全球节点分布、边缘缓存、链上链下事件索引器与统一监控告警(SLA、SLO)。
四、链码(智能合约)实务与专家洞悉
- 设计原则:最小权限、不可变性优先、模块化、易审计。
- 升级模式:慎用代理合约(Proxy)与可升级逻辑,升级需伴随多签与Timelock审查流程。
- 测试策略:单元测试、整合测试、主网相同配置下的混合回归测试与攻击模拟场景。
五、高性能数据库与链上索引方案
- 节点状态存储:采用RocksDB/LevelDB作为链节点状态存储以保证写入速率与恢复能力。

- 索引与查询层:事件流使用Kafka/CDC,入库到时序/文档数据库(Postgres+timescaledb / ElasticSearch)供钱包前端快速检索。
- 缓存与并发:Redis作为热数据缓存,CQRS分离写与读路径,使用分区与水平扩展处理高并发请求。
- 数据一致性:弱一致性场景采用幂等设计与补偿机制,必须场景采用强一致复制与事务日志。
六、面向数字化生活方式的产品设计建议
- 简化用户路径:社交恢复、助记词抽象、人机验证最小化、个性化资产展示。
- 隐私与控制:选择性披露、链下数据加密、允许用户控制KYC数据共享范围。
七、综合建议清单(工程+运营)
1) 采用混合验证桥:链上轻证明+链下多签验证器;2) 对关键合约做形式化验证并开启赏金;3) 建立零日快速响应SOP与演练;4) 全球部署配合本地合规与低延迟网络;5) 索引层用Kafka→Postgres/ES→Redis的分层架构以支撑高并发查询;6) 产品上抽象gas并优化UX,推进社交恢复与隐私保护。
结语:TPWallet在实现BSC到ERC的跨链转移时,既要在桥的设计上保证可验证性与最小信任,也要在开发与运维上构建多层次的零日防护与快速响应机制。同时,面向全球用户的产品需要把合规、低延迟、优秀的用户体验与数据治理统筹起来。将链码审计、高性能数据架构与持续安全运营结合,才能既守住资产安全又降低用户门槛,推动数字化生活方式的普及。
评论
SkyWalker
很全面的技术与运营建议,特别赞同多签+Timelock的组合。
小白
对普通用户来说,抽象gas和社交恢复最吸引人,期待实现!
Maya
关于零日响应的SOP能否分享一个模板?这篇给了很好方向。
链圈老王
高性能数据库部分实用,Kafka+Postgres+Redis的组合很适合索引层。
Neo
建议补充一下桥的经济攻击面(闪贷、价格预言机操纵)防护细节。